Customer Concentration Risk — Managers Only

Brellix Group now accounts for 41% of recurring revenue, up from 28% last year. Any contraction in their Halden division would materially affect our forecast. Mitigation work is underway to broaden the mid-market base. Incoming director should review the diversification plan summarised below before the quarterly review.

internal memo for kaduf-baduf: Only 35 of the 378 pilot accounts renewed Holir, so a churn review is set for June 11. Eliielax Group is in early talks to buy Silaelix Group for about $142.1 million.

This PR enables the Fernwheel ticket-pricing experiment behind the `pricing_curve_v2` flag, default off. It introduces a demand-weighted adjustment applied only to the Harbor City venue cohort, with a hard floor and ceiling so no customer sees a price outside the approved band. Rollback is a flag flip; no schema changes ship with this. All adjustment logic is pure and unit-tested against the finance team's fixture set. The experiment constants are defined below.

tuning constants:
QUOTAS = {
    "druwyn": 5,
    "holix": 5,
    "zorath": 5,
    "holwyn": 10,
}

**Q: Why does the Lintaro app route deep links through RouteHub?** All inbound links hit RouteHub first so we can version paths independently of app releases. Reviewers: reject PRs that hardcode screen routes. Fallback behavior opens the home tab if a route is unknown. The staging route-table editor is locked; to unlock it during review, enter the recovery passphrase listed directly beneath this answer.

vault phrase of tajeg-tageg = pelix-druix-holius-briael-zorwyn-frawyn-fraox-norok-drueth-aldiel